SMH Description
The investment seeks to replicate as closely as possible, before fees and expenses, the price and yield performance of the Market Vectors US Listed Semiconductor 25 Index (the "Semiconductor Index"). The fund normally invests at least 80% of its total assets in securities that comprise the fund's benchmark index. The Semiconductor Index is comprised of common stocks and depositary receipts of U.S. exchange-listed companies in the semiconductor industry. Such companies may include medium-capitalization companies and foreign companies that are listed on a U.S. exchange. The fund is non-diversified.

SPTE Description
The S&P Global 1200 Shariah Information Technology Capped Index is designed to measure the performance of global large-cap equity securities within the information technology sector that pass rules-based screens for adherence to Shariah investment guidelines, with a cap applied to ensure diversification among companies in the index.
